Runn provides a scheduling UI built around assignment moves, so planners can re-balance workload without rebuilding plans from scratch. Resource availability drives the scheduling grid, and Runn validates overlaps to support resource conflict detection when multiple requests target the same people. The workflow supports team coordination across projects through a shared view of commitments and planned work windows.
The main tradeoff is that deep enterprise governance features like granular audit log retention and advanced RBAC policies are not the product’s most emphasized capability, so larger organizations may need extra administrative discipline. Runn fits best when service operations need fast iteration on staffing plans and want schedule updates to flow into other tools through automation and an API-based integration approach.

Resource Guru centers day-to-day scheduling with a drag-and-drop booking flow, availability calendars, and booking constraints like booking buffers and time windows. It supports shared resource pools, shared availability, and multi-resource reservations so a single booking can reserve multiple staff members or assets together. Teams can administer access by user roles, set non-availability blackout dates, and configure per-resource booking rules to keep scheduling consistent across locations.
A key tradeoff is that advanced portfolio-level capacity planning and cross-project workload balancing need more setup and may require external tooling for deeper analytics. Resource Guru fits service operations where scheduling accuracy and operational handoffs matter more than enterprise capacity modeling. It is a stronger fit when integration targets are calendar workflows and request intake rather than complex ERP-driven allocation logic.

Saviom’s scheduling approach supports multi-project planning with time-phased allocation and an availability calendar that can incorporate non-availability blackout dates. The system emphasizes skills-aware assignment and resource conflict detection to reduce rework when staffing changes happen midstream. Utilization reporting supports ongoing workload balancing and bench utilization tracking so managers can compare forecast demand with actual commitments.
A key tradeoff is that configuration around skills taxonomy and allocation rules requires careful governance to keep matching consistent across departments. Saviom fits best when service teams run frequent staffing updates and need repeatable scheduling logic connected to incoming project demand.

How to Choose the Right online resource scheduling software
Service teams often evaluate online resource scheduling software by how quickly schedule edits propagate into shared staffing plans and how tightly the tool prevents overlaps during assignment changes. This guide covers Runn, Resource Guru, Saviom, Float, Teamdeck, Birdview, Planisware Orchestra, Scoro, Ganttic, and monday.com Resource Management.
The decision usually hinges on conflict validation behavior, multi-resource booking coverage, and whether automation ties resource requests to schedule updates without manual rework. Runn and Float are used as concrete references for calendar-first scheduling with immediate constraint feedback and scenario comparison workflows.
Online resource scheduling features that determine scheduling accuracy and control
Accurate scheduling hinges on how the tool validates overlaps during the edit itself and how fast it reflects rebalancing across shared projects. Runn prevents overlap by validating drag-and-drop assignment changes as edits happen, so planners avoid exporting a conflicting schedule and then fixing it in downstream views.
Control depth matters when demand changes frequently because approvals, governed edit paths, and API-driven updates decide who can change allocations and how those changes propagate. Planisware Orchestra routes allocation changes through configuration-driven approval and synchronization tied to portfolio planning decisions, while monday.com Resource Management triggers schedule updates through board-level automation tied to request status and dependency steps.
Overlap validation during scheduling edits
Runn blocks conflicting assignments at the moment a planner drags to reassign and provides immediate rebalancing feedback. Teamdeck flags overlapping assignments during drag-and-drop edits rather than after report export.
Multi-resource booking in a single action
Resource Guru supports booking multiple staff or assets in one scheduling action so planners avoid partial coverage gaps. Float focuses on capacity tie-ins that keep planned allocations and actual assignments visible during edits.
Skills-based assignment logic with governed rules
Saviom uses skills-aware staffing logic to automate assignment decisions across changing demand and capacity constraints. Ganttic requires consistent role and skill taxonomy setup so scheduling blocks remain aligned across teams.
Scenario comparison tied to allocations and capacity
Float keeps scenario planning and planned capacity versus actual assignment views in one workflow tied to a capacity-focused model. Planisware Orchestra compares scenario-based planning outcomes against constraints while routing changes through governance.
Availability blackout dates and non-availability enforcement
Birdview links availability blackout dates directly to conflict detection across shared resource pools. Ganttic handles blackout-date logic by blocking assignments during non-availability periods.
Automation and API-backed updates from scheduling workflow fields
Scoro uses an API-backed automation approach that links project workflow fields to staffing updates and external scheduling data. monday.com Resource Management uses board-level automation to move resource requests through status and schedule update steps so changes flow from request intake into planning views.

Common implementation pitfalls for online resource scheduling software
Most planning failures come from mismatched workflow expectations rather than missing UI features. Tools that validate conflicts only when data is entered consistently still fail if teams do not follow shared entry rules across projects and boards.
Another frequent failure is underestimating governance configuration time when edit approvals and role controls must align with portfolio planning workflows. Planisware Orchestra requires careful setup of roles, workflows, and mapping, and Saviom requires ongoing governance of skills taxonomy and allocation rules.
Treating conflict detection as a late report step instead of an edit-time validation behavior
Select Runn or Teamdeck when planners need overlap prevention during drag-and-drop edits, because late conflict discovery still produces rework in shared staffing plans.
Allowing skill and role taxonomy drift across teams
Use governance discipline for Saviom skills taxonomy and Saviom allocation rules because ongoing governance is required for skills-based scheduling to remain accurate. Keep consistent role and skill taxonomy setup across teams for Ganttic to prevent misalignment.
Overpromising governance depth without planning the approval and mapping workload
Planisware Orchestra administration requires careful configuration of roles, workflows, and mapping, so governance rollout must include time for those governance artifacts. monday.com Resource Management governance needs careful workspace and permissions planning for schedules so the automation does not move requests into incorrect planning states.
Building interactive scheduling around blackout dates without maintaining shared availability definitions
Birdview and Ganttic both rely on blackout-date logic, so the blackout definition process must stay current across shared resource pools or conflict detection will look inconsistent.
